A Live Picture in Picture, also known as a Live PIP, is a notification in The Sims and The Sims 2 that appears during certain events. A Live PIP is a small box, usually to the bottom right of the screen, with a live camera witnessing the event. It can be closed by clicking on its X button. Clicking on the capturing screen will transport the game camera to that event, subsequently closing down the PIP window and to initial camera location by clicking again. By clicking on and dragging the top edge of the box allows for movement and reposition of the window on the screen.

A Live PIP shows the player what's going on in the event of a fire, a burglary, and a repo-man visit, among other things. These also include when:

  • Someone gets fit or fat.[TS2]
  • Somebody ages.[TS2]
  • Somebody rings a doorbell.
  • When an NPC arrives or leaves.(might be only for specific ones)[confirmation needed]
  • Household member starts stomping on cockroaches.
